
Deanna Nealey is a retired middle school teacher, who taught many years in Penfield, NY. When she and her husband, Richard, moved to Plymouth, MA, she was fascinated by the Genghis Swan story that was happening close to her home in The Pinehills. Every time she drove past the pond on the Eel River, where Genghis lived, she looked for him and was eager to tell his story to visitors. She is happy that now Genghis has his own book to be read and enjoyed by her grandchildren and other children.
